Required side and rear setbacks at a home on North Cherry can be reduced for a building addition, the Mesa Board of Adjustment decided recently.

The board voted 5-0 Sept. 3 as part of a consent agenda with other items to approve a minor modification to an existing planned-area development overlay. It allows the reduction to the required setbacks and an increase to the maximum lot and building coverage on 0.12 acres at 1025 N. Cherry. Board members Heath Reed and Troy Glover were absent.

The existing home is 2,639 square feet and there is a proposed 215-square-foot addition in the southeast corner of the lot, Staff Planner Emily Johnson said during a study session prior to the meeting.
